Labour Embarks on Image Overhaul

The Department of Labor and Industrial Relations has embarked on transforming its corporate image with the launch of its new uniforms yesterday.

Secretary, George Vaso, urged his staff to uphold professionalism in their duties and not to bring the company into disrepute with their conduct.

 

He says, the department has a vital role in improving workers’ welfare and that must not be compromised.

 

The launch is in line with the departments’ Medium Term Development Strategy (MTDS).

 

It is aimed at portraying a good corporate image to all stakeholders.

 

Secretary Vaso, told his staff to take pride in their new corporate wear.

 

He says, for too long the department has been complacent on its performance and hopes this will change the mindset of employees.

 

He expects change and will be tough on those who do not comply.

 

Minister for Labor and Industrial Relations, Mark Maipakai, reaffirmed the government’s commitment to the department.

 

Field officers within the department will be given a different set of uniforms suitable to their working environment.
